Septic Tanks: An Overview
A septic tank is an underground wastewater treatment system commonly used in rural and suburban areas where centralized sewage systems are not available. It is designed to collect and treat wastewater from household plumbing, including toilets, sinks, and showers. The primary function of a septic tank is to separate solids from liquids, allowing for the natural decomposition of organic matter through anaerobic bacteria.
How Septic Tanks Work
The septic tank operates on a simple principle. Wastewater flows into the tank through an inlet pipe, where it is held for a period of time. During this time, heavier solids settle to the bottom, forming a sludge layer, while lighter materials, such as grease and oils, float to the top, creating a scum layer. The middle layer, known as effluent, is the liquid that exits the tank through an outlet pipe and is typically directed to a drain field or leach field for further treatment and absorption into the soil.
The effectiveness of a septic system relies on proper design, installation, and maintenance. Homeowners are responsible for regular inspections and pumping of the tank to prevent buildup of solids, which can lead to system failure.
The Importance of Rainfall and Ground Saturation
The relationship between rainfall and septic tank performance is crucial for homeowners to understand. Heavy rain can lead to saturated soil conditions, which may overwhelm the drain field’s capacity to absorb effluent. When the ground is saturated, any additional wastewater from the septic tank has nowhere to go, potentially causing backups into the tank and even into the home.

Addressing Septic Tank Backup Risks Due to Rain
Heavy rainfall can pose significant risks to septic systems, leading to potential backups and system failures. Homeowners should be aware of various strategies to mitigate these risks and ensure their septic systems function properly even during wet conditions.
Understanding the Risks
When rainwater saturates the ground, it can overwhelm the drain field’s ability to absorb effluent. This saturation can lead to several issues:
- Increased pressure on the septic tank, causing backups.
- Potential for effluent to surface in the yard, creating health hazards.
- Contamination of nearby water sources.
Preventive Measures
Homeowners can take several proactive steps to reduce the likelihood of septic tank backups during heavy rainfall:
1. Regular Maintenance
Routine maintenance is essential for the longevity of a septic system. Homeowners should:
- Schedule regular inspections by a qualified septic service provider.
- Pump the septic tank every 3 to 5 years, or as recommended based on household size and usage.
2. Monitor Drain Field Conditions
Keep an eye on the drain field, especially after heavy rains. Homeowners should:
- Look for signs of pooling water or unusually lush vegetation, which may indicate saturation.
- Avoid parking vehicles or placing heavy objects on the drain field to prevent soil compaction.
3. Manage Water Usage
During periods of heavy rain, it’s wise to limit water usage to reduce the volume of wastewater entering the septic system. Homeowners can:
- Postpone laundry and dishwashing until after the rain subsides.
- Take shorter showers and avoid running multiple water fixtures simultaneously.
Improving Drainage Around the Septic System
Proper drainage around the septic system can help prevent water from pooling and saturating the area. Homeowners can consider the following options:
1. Grading and Landscaping
Ensure that the land around the septic system slopes away from the tank and drain field. This can be achieved by:
- Regrading the soil to create a slope that directs rainwater away.
- Planting grass or other vegetation that can help absorb excess water.
2. Installing Drainage Systems
If the property frequently experiences flooding or pooling, homeowners may want to install additional drainage solutions:
- French drains can redirect water away from the septic area.
- Swales or ditches can be created to channel water away from the drain field.

Long-Term Solutions
For homeowners in areas prone to heavy rainfall, considering long-term solutions may be beneficial:
1. Upgrade the Septic System
If backups are a frequent issue, it may be time to evaluate the septic system. Options include:
- Installing a larger tank to accommodate higher volumes of wastewater.
- Upgrading to a more advanced system, such as a mound system, that can handle excess water more effectively.
2. Consult with Professionals
Engaging with septic system professionals can provide tailored solutions. Homeowners should:
- Seek advice on the best practices for their specific location and soil type.
- Consider a site evaluation to determine the best septic system design for their property.

Costs and Maintenance of Septic Systems
Understanding the expenses and maintenance requirements of a septic system is crucial for homeowners, especially in relation to the risks posed by heavy rainfall. Regular maintenance can prevent costly repairs and ensure the system operates efficiently.
Typical Expenses
The costs associated with owning and maintaining a septic system can vary widely based on location, system type, and specific needs. Here are some typical expenses homeowners should anticipate:
| Service | Estimated Cost |
|---|---|
| Septic Tank Pumping | $300 – $500 every 3 to 5 years |
| Septic System Inspection | $100 – $300 annually |
| Septic System Repair | $1,000 – $5,000 (depending on the issue) |
| Septic System Replacement | $3,000 – $15,000 (depending on the system type) |

Longevity of Septic Tanks and Components
The lifespan of a septic tank and its components can vary based on material, maintenance, and environmental factors. Here’s a general overview:
| Component | Typical Lifespan |
|---|---|
| Concrete Septic Tank | 40 – 50 years |
| Fiberglass Septic Tank | 30 – 40 years |
| Plastic Septic Tank | 20 – 30 years |
| Drain Field | 20 – 30 years |
Common Mistakes to Avoid
Homeowners can inadvertently cause issues with their septic systems by making common mistakes. To avoid these pitfalls, consider the following:
- Flushing inappropriate items down the toilet, such as wipes, feminine hygiene products, or chemicals.
- Neglecting regular pumping and maintenance, leading to system failure.
- Overloading the system with excessive water usage, especially during heavy rain.
- Ignoring signs of trouble, such as slow drains or foul odors, which can indicate a problem.
- Planting trees or shrubs too close to the septic system, as roots can invade and damage components.

Safety Tips
Safety is paramount when dealing with septic systems. Here are some essential safety tips for homeowners:
1. Avoid Direct Contact
When inspecting or working around the septic system, homeowners should:
- Wear protective clothing, including gloves and boots.
- Avoid direct contact with wastewater, as it can contain harmful pathogens.
2. Be Cautious of Gas Emissions
Septic tanks can produce harmful gases, such as methane and hydrogen sulfide. Homeowners should:
- Ensure proper ventilation when working near the tank.
- Never enter a septic tank without proper safety equipment and training.

When to Call a Professional
There are specific situations when homeowners should seek professional help:
1. Signs of System Failure
If homeowners notice any of the following signs, it’s time to call a professional:
- Slow drains or backups in multiple fixtures.
- Unpleasant odors near the septic tank or drain field.
- Pooling water or unusually lush vegetation over the drain field.
